480 likes | 676 Views
Webcast Hyper -V R2 Sp1. Miguel Hernández Consultor Pre-venta I.T. MVP / MCTS Windows Server Virtualization mhernandez@zerkana.com http://undercpd.blogspot.com. Agenda. Overview Hyper -V R2 – Capacidades y tecnología Hyper -V R2 Sp1 Alta disponibilidad Formación Fundamentos Redes
E N D
WebcastHyper-V R2 Sp1 Miguel Hernández Consultor Pre-venta I.T. MVP / MCTS Windows Server Virtualization mhernandez@zerkana.com http://undercpd.blogspot.com
Agenda • Overview • Hyper-V R2 – Capacidades y tecnología • Hyper-V R2 Sp1 • Alta disponibilidad • Formación • Fundamentos • Redes • Almacenamiento • Memoria • Buenas prácticas
Funcionalidades de Hyper-V R2 • Partición Padre: • 64 Procesadores Lógicos • 1Tb de RAM • Particiones hijas (Máquinas Virtuales): • 32-bit (x86) y 64-bit (x64) • RAM: Hasta 64 GB de memoria • SMP con 2/4 Procesadores Lógicos • 385 VMs en ejecución concurrente por host O 512 Procesadores Virtuales. • Hasta 16 nodos por Cluster: 1000 VMs por cluster o 384 VMs por nodo • Almacenamiento: Formato VHD y acceso Pass-Through a disco • Networking: Soporte a NLB, VLAN Tagging, TCP Offload, VMQ, Jumbo Frames… • Live Backup: Integración con VolumeShadowService • Estándar DMTF para interfaz de gestión por WMI • Snapshots • Manipulación Offline del virtual hard disk
Extensión .VHD Almacenamiento físico DirectAttach Storage (DAS): SATA, eSATA, PATA, SAS, SCSI, USB, Firewire Storage Area Networks (SANs): iSCSI, FiberChannel, SAS Network Attached Storage (NAS) Agregar / Quitar VHDs y discos pass-through a VMs en ejecución sin requerir un reinicio Aplica a dispositivos que se conecten a la virtual SCSI controller Permite Crecimientos del almacenamiento de las VMs sin paradas. Nuevos escenarios de backup Nuevos escenarios de SQL/Exchange Almacenamiento
Windows Server 2008 R2 Hyper-V vs. Microsoft Hyper-V Server 2008 R2 Microsoft Hyper-V Server Microsoft Hyper-V Server 2008 R2 (HVS) Hyper-V como role de Windows Server 2008 R2 VM VM Partición Padre Hyper-V Hyper-V MISMAS FUNCIONALIDADES Hardware VM VM Partición Padre Windows Server Hyper-V Hardware Descargagratuitaqueincluye el hypervisor y todos los componentesnecesariosparavirtualizar (Windows Kernel, drivers, red, almacenamiento…) Disponiblecomo role en unainstalación “full” o “Server Core” de Windows Server 2008
Primeros pasos con Hyper-V Server • Confguración IP • netshinterface ip set address "<Adapter Name>" static ipaddrsubnetmask gateway metric. • 2. Introducción de equipo en dominio. • netdomjoin<EQUIPO> /domain:<DOMINIO> /userd:<USUARIO> /passwordd:* • shutdown /t 0 /r • 3. Conf. de firewall y activación de administraciónremota. • netshadvfirewall firewall set rule group="Remote Administration" new enable=yes • cscript\windows\system32\scregedit.wsf /ar 0 cscript\windows\system32\scregedit.wsf /cs 0 • shutdown/t 0 /r • 4. Servicio hyper-v – Automático • BCDEdit /set hypervisorlaunchtype auto • i
Administración desde consola remota • Comando: «DCOMCNFG» • Botón derecho- Propiedades sobre Mi PC • Solapa «Com Security» • En «Access Permissión» elegir «EditLimits» • «Anonymuslogon» en «GroupUserName» permitir «Remote Access»
Windows Server 2008 R2 SP1 Dynamic Memory RemoteFX Microsoft RemoteFXaprovecha la potencia de los recursos gráficos virtualizados y códecs avanzados para recrear la fidelidad de la aceleración de gráficos asistida por hardware, incluyendo soporte para contenido en 3D y Aero de Windows, en el dispositivo de un usuario remoto. DynamicMemory permite la asignación de un intervalo de memoria (mínimo y máximo) para máquinas virtuales individuales, lo que permite al sistema ajustar dinámicamente el uso de memoria de la máquina virtual basada en la demanda. Esto proporciona una mayor coherencia en el rendimiento del sistema que permite una mejor gestión para los administradores,
Guest compatibles con D.M. Solamente los siguientes sistemas operativos son compatibles con la versión beta:•Windows Server 2003 Enterprise & Datacenter (32-bit y 64-bit)•Windows Server 2003 R2 Enterprise & Datacenter (32-bit y 64-bit)•Windows Server 2008 Enterprise & Datacenter (32-bit y 64-bit)•Windows Server 2008 R2 Enterprise & Datacenter (64-bit)•Windows Vista Enterprise & Ultimate (32-bit y 64-bit)•Windows 7 Enterprise & Ultimate (32-bit y 64-bit).Los siguientes sistemas operativos serán compatibles posterior a la versión beta:•Windows Server 2003 Web & Standard (32-bit y 64-bit)•Windows Server 2003 R2 Web & Standard (32-bit y 64-bit)•Windows Server 2008 Web & Standard (32-bit y 64-bit)•Windows Server 2008 R2 Web & Standard (64-bit).”
Alta disponibilidad Quick Migration vs. Live Migration • Live Migration • (Windows Server 2008 R2Hyper-V) • Estado de la VM y Transferencia de la Memoria • Crea la VM en el destino • Mueve páginas de memoria desde el origen al destino via Ethernet de manera iterativa • Transferencia final del estado y restauración de la VM • Pausa la máquina virtual • Mueve el almacenamiento desde el origen al destino • Continua la ejecución • Atención: Misma marca de procesador • Quick Migration • (Windows Server 2008 Hyper-V) • Salva el estado de ejecución • Crea la VM en el destino • Escribe la memoria de la VM en el almacenamiento compartido • Mueve la VM • Mueve la conectividad del almacenamiento del host origen al host destino • Restaura el estado y continua la ejecución • Lee la memoria de la VM del almacenamiento compartido y la restaura en el host destino • Continua la ejecución Host 2 Host 1 Host 1 Host 2
Requisitos del host: • Sistema Operativo: Incluido en WS 2008 R2 x64 – soporta V.m. 32 y 64 bits. • Memoria: 512 partición padre + 8mb * Vm / 32 mb en cada Vm para drivers. • Procesador: 64 Bits. – Intel VT o AMD-V • Bios: Soporta Virtualización asistida por Hardware • Activar opción en BIOS - APAGAR Y ENCENDER SERVIDOR
Máquinas Virtuales Similar a máquinas físicas • Bios – Modificar orden de arranque • Memoria : • +32 mb. * Máquina virtual • Hasta 64 gb * Máquina virtual • Procesador : • 32 y 64 bits. • Hasta 4 procesadores * Máquina virtual. • Se puede configurar limitación de Proc / Máquina Virt. • Modo Procesador anterior a Windows NT. • Migración de V.M. entre procesadores distintos. • Virtual Floppy– Físicos o .vfd. • Controladores de almacenamiento • Redes
IntegrationServices VmServices
IntegrationServices • OperatingSystemShutdwon: Ordena un apagado ordenado en el servidor. • Time Synchronization: Sincroniza la hora con el padre. • Data Exchange: Escribe información referente a hyper-v en el registro del hijo o el padre. • Hearbeat: Reporta el estado de la V.M. a través de un latido. • Backup (volumesnapshot): Ordena una instantanea de volumen en el «guest» ante un backup en el «host».
Redes Internas Externas Privadas
Redes Externa Virtual - Interna Virtual Física Virtual - Privada j Lan Vlan1
Redes • No Adaptadores Inalámbricos • Adaptador de Red Heredado • No VmServices • No producción • S.o. antes de instalar V.M. services. • Adaptador de Red / V.M. Services • Mac - Estática o Dinámica • Vlan Id – Vlans • Es posible compartir el adaptador entre hyper-v y host
Redes –Importante en Ws2008R2. • Un paquete de continuación de actualizaciones de Hyper-V está disponible para un equipo que ejecuta Windows Server 2008 R2 • http://support.microsoft.com/kb/975354/es • La conexión de red de una ejecución se pierde la máquina virtual de Hyper-V bajo intenso tráfico de red saliente en un equipo basado en Windows Server • http://support.microsoft.com/kb/974909/es • Network connectivity for a Windows Server 2003-based Hyper-V virtual machine is lost temporarily in Windows Server 2008 R2 • http://support.microsoft.com/kb/981836/es
Controladoras • Ide • Scsi
Controladora Ide • Disco de arranque. • Flopy, HDD y DVD. • Ligada a los V.M. Services. • Cada V.M. tiene dos Ide = Ide: 0 C: , Ide 1: DVD. • Emulado - afecta al rendimiento de la V.M. • Cada IDE soporta 4 HDD.
Controladora Scsi • No disco de arranque. • No Floppy y DVD. • Más rápido que IDE y no penaliza al procesador. • ¡64 Discos! • Se pueden añadir discos en caliente
Discos Duros Tamaño Fijo Tamaño Dinámico Pass-Trought Diferenciales
Discos de tamaño Fijo • Extensión .VHD • Hasta 2 Tb. • Se pueden convertir de Dinámico a Fijo y Fijo a Dinámico (crea un segundo disco). • Por defecto los discos son fijos. • Mayor Rendimiento. • Se pueden editar y ampliar (no reducir).
Discos tamaño variable • Extensión .VHD • Se pueden convertir de Dinámico a Fijo y Fijo a Dinámico (crea un segundo disco). • Menor Rendimiento. • Se pueden editar y ampliar (no reducir). • No aconsejables en producción. Tamaño de .vhd
Discos Pass-Trought • Directamente ven el disco asignado desde partición el Padre / Host. • Mayor rendimiento. • Poner Off-line Disco y asignar letra. • Pueden ser unidades USB (Discos Externos).
Discos diferenciales • El disco hijo afecta al rendimiendo del padre. • Se pueden descartar cambios. • Se pueden fusionar. • Controlar los permisos NTFS • Puedes aplicar cambios realizados en discos hijos a disco padre. • El padre puedes estar en una carpeta sin permiso de escritura.
Edición de discos • Compactar - Reduce el tamaño sea NTFS o no NTFS. (Llena espacios con ceros) • Convertir – Dinámico a Fijo y viceversa. • Expandir – Aumentar. • Fusionar – Discos diferencias Padre e Hijo. • Reconectar – Discos Padres e hijos.
Memoria – buenas prácticas - • Memoria en el host : 512mb. (aconsejable 1024mb.) partición padre + 8mb * Vm / 32 mb en cada Vm para drivers • Cada Servidor virtual requiere la misma memoria que en físico • Evita la paginación • Asigna recursos «manualmente» estáticos de forma dinámica
Dynamic Memory • Reasigna dinámicamente el 100% de la memoria del host ¿Resultados? Incrementa la densidad de máquinas virtuales. Gestión eficiente de la memoria. • Page Sharing - Era posible encontrar dos 4kb iguales, ¿pero dos 2mb. iguales?. • El hypervisor paginará lo paginable y asignará más memoria si el guest intenta paginar lo no paginable. (Para eso hay que entender al guest) • Rendimiento del host asegurado: HKLM:/SOFTWARE/Microsoft/Windows NT/CurrentVersion/Virtualizationmemoryreserve (Dword = valor).
Asigna más memoria de la que hay disponible Eliminación de páginas duplicadas perjudica rendimiento Paginación desde el gestor de virtualización Overcommit Memory Overcommit = Overbooking
Alta disponibilidad • Clústering
Alta disponibilidad • ¿Sin unidad San?, ¿con licencias de servidor Standard?, DoubleTake.
www.doubletake.com Physical to Physical Virtual to Physical Virtual to Virtual Physical to Virtual
How Double-Take Replication Works S.T.A.R : Sequential Transfer Asynchronous Replication Applications Applications Any IP Network Operating System Operating System Double-Take Filter Double-Take Filter • Advantages : • Real Time Asynchronous Replication, • Bandwidth optimization, • Intelligent compression, • Byte level replication, • VSS snapshot integration • Data consistency with sequential data transmission,9915 File System File System Hardware Layer Hardware Layer QUEUEING: Memory: 32-1024 MB (128 MB default). HDD :Size depents on infrastructure.
www.doubletake.com Demo
Gracias Miguel Hernández Consultor Pre-venta I.T. MVP / MCTS Windows Server Virtualization mhernandez@zerkana.com http://undercpd.blogspot.com